Flood Watch Continues for Northern New York and Most of Vermont until 2 PM Today

Additional river rises are expected with minor and localized ice jam flooding possible Today. Also, minor open water flooding is forecasted on the Ausable River and Otter Creek, with Action Stage possible on the Lamoille, Winooski, Mad, Barton, and Missisquoi Rivers Today. The threat for flooding ends by tonight. Read More >
